This project is devoted to the creation of an open source Error-Correcting Output Codes (ECOC) library for the MachineLearning community. The ECOC framework is a powerful tool to deal with multi-class categorization problems.

TextMarker is now developed and hosted at Apache UIMA (http://uima.apache.org/textmarker.html). TextMarker is a UIMA-based tool for information extraction and more. The full featured editor of the rule language and the build process of UIMA descriptors are complemented with components for visualization, explanation, testing and rule learning.
Cougar Squared is a new Javalibrary for machinelearning and data mining research, supporting research needs of the community. It is written by researchers for researchers. It extends the WEKA and YALE machinelearning frameworks.

BIL++ is a set of standalone C++ packages for data processing in Bioinformatics (Graph mining, Bayesian networks, Genetic algorithm, Discretization, Gene expression data analysis, Hypothesis testing).
Feating constructs a classification ensemble comprising a set of local models. It is effective at reducing the error of both stable and unstable learners, including SVM. For details see the paper at http://dx.doi.org/10.1007/s10994-010-5224-5.
Leark is a Data Mining library developed in C#.NET. It contains several methods for ranking web documents described with a set of normalized features, and a feature selection algorithm. The methods are based on perceptron and clustering.
The aim of ALIVE is to develop new approaches to the engineering of flexible, adaptable distributed service-oriented systems based on the adaptation of social coordination and organisation mechanisms.
RoboBeans is an interface to the "Robocup 2D Soccer Simulation Server" that allows developers to write Robocup teams\agents concentrating on behaviour and AI without having to worry about syntax of communication or network issues.
Multi-Core optimized Perceptron Network is a high-performance artificial neural network specially designed for workstations with multi-core CPUs, implemented as a shared library and coded in C++.
The data complexity library, DCoL, is a machinelearning software that implements all metrics to characterize the apparent complexity of classification problems. The code is implemented in C++ and can be run on multiple platforms.

This project applies an interpretation of a k-NN algorithm to a library of GPS commuter data for speed prediction. The overall goal is to lay the foundation for a power management protocol for use in electric vehicles with hybrid energy storage.
KeplerWeka adds the functionality of the open-source machine learning and data mining workbench WEKA to the free and open-source, scientific workflow application, Kepler.
The STAIR Vision Library (SVL), originally developed to support the STanford AI Robot, provides software infrastructure for computer vision, machinelearning, and probabilistic graphical models.
Yann is Yet Another Neural Network. Yann is a library to create fast neural networks. It is also a GUI to easily create, edit, train, execute and investigate networks. Multiple topologies, runtime properties and ensemble learning are supported.
PhiWeave is a machinelearninglibrary for structured prediction via factor graphs. It is part of an ongoing effort to implement and improve on the current state-of-the-art in inference and parameter estimation for graphical models.
